5 min readNew DelhiMay 26, 2026 01:49 PM IST Imtiaz Ali, known for films like Jab We Met, Chamkila, Highway, among many others, is gearing up for his next release, Main Vaapas Aaunga, starring Diljit Dosanjh, Naseeruddin Shah, Sharvari and Vedang Raina in lead roles. In a recent interview, when Imtiaz was asked about a sequel or remake of his much-loved film Jab We Met, he said that Vedang and Sharvari would fit the bill perfectly. However, in a new interview, Vedang said that he took this comment “with a pinch of salt”. And Imtiaz declared that while he is not interested in revisiting the world of Jab We Met, he has no problems if someone else made another iteration of Jab We Met. What happened to Geet and Aditya after Jab We Met? It’s a question that atleast officially, we won’t get an answer to. Imtiaz Ali’s Jab We Met is counted as a cult Hindi film In a candid conversation with Sonal Kalra, Chief Managing Editor, Entertainment and Lifestyle, Hindustan Times, on The Right Angle, filmmaker Imtiaz Ali revealed that he has no plans for a Jab We Met 2, or even a Tamasha 2. “I do keep hearing about it. To those who ask me about them, I say, ‘Love Aaj Kal 2 bhi toh banayi thi na, voh toh itni achhi nahi gayi’,” he says, pointing out that sequels do not automatically guarantee love or success. Also read: I’d like to thank them for bringing audiences to theatres: Imtiaz Ali praises Aditya Dhar, Ranveer Singh’s Dhurandhar 2 “I feel that if there’s something that comes that strongly to me as a maker, then I will,” he explains, “But I don’t think, especially for Jab We Met, I won’t. Diljit Dosanjh offers to star in Jab We Met 2 with Kareena Kapoor. Diljit Dosanjh said he would love to work with Kareena Kapoor and Imtiaz Ali together. He even offered to star in Jab We Met 2. Diljit Dosanjh offered to star in Jab We Met 2 with Kareena Kapoor. Diljit has often spoken about his admiration for Kareena. The duo has worked together in three films — Udta Punjab, Good Newwz and recently released Crew. He even compared her with Rihanna and Beyonce at a recent event. On the other hand, Diljit recently worked with Imtiaz Ali. The Punjabi actor-singer collaborated with the filmmaker for Amar Singh Chamkila and has been all praise for Imtiaz ever since. Given his admiration for both, Diljit was put in the spot in an interview with Anubhav Singh Bassi for Netflix India wherein he was asked if he could pick one, who would he worked with again — Kareena or Imtiaz. Amar Singh Chamkila is all set to release on Netflix on April 12. Imtiaz Ali spoke about Kareena Kapoor and Shahid Kapoor starrer Jab We Met. Imtiaz Ali recently said that if he hypothetically had to make a sequel of Kareena Kapoor Khan and Shahid Kapoor’s film Jab We Met, he would cast Parineeti Chopra and Diljit Dosanjh. The Imtiaz Ali directorial venture became a huge hit when it was released, praised by fans and critics alike. It went on to become a cult favourite film among fans of the romantic comedy genre. While Imtiaz Ali has denied several times that he will not a sequel of the film, the craze around the film never lets him truly escape the question. Imtiaz recently told India Today, “When the film was re-released in theatres last year, people really gave a lot of love.
